Output e3914f63071d5db8ee63990ce0b2f3eafb03a3bef8a74a177d9608a4b745988e:3

value
108894902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7b3ddf9ba735698b1c320ebee9e2b93bb3f7964 OP_EQUAL
address
MQeVMvJR9jZxGLi5xsoKYChYEmmJXA7prY
transaction
e3914f63071d5db8ee63990ce0b2f3eafb03a3bef8a74a177d9608a4b745988e
spent
true